Slurm: гасеница претворена во пеперутка

Slurm: гасеница претворена во пеперутка

  1. Slurm навистина ви овозможува да влезете во темата Kubernetes или да го подобрите вашето знаење.
  2. Учесниците се среќни. Има само неколку од оние кои не научиле ништо ново или не ги решиле своите проблеми. Безусловниот поврат на пари од првиот ден („Ако сметате дека Слурм не ви одговара, ќе ви ја вратиме целосната цена на билетот“) го искористи само едно лице, оправдувајќи се дека ја преценил својата сила.
  3. Следниот Slurm ќе се одржи на почетокот на септември во Санкт Петербург. Selectel, нашиот постојан спонзор, обезбедува не само облак за штандови, туку и своја конференциска сала.
  4. Го повторуваме основниот Slurm (9-11 септември) и воведуваме нова програма: DevOps Slurm (4-6 септември).

Што е Slurm и како се промени?

Пред една година дојдовме до идеја да спроведеме курсеви за Кубернетес. Во август 18-та година се одржа Слурм-1: тешко, со континуирано претставување (кога ќе заврши презентацијата на сцената), со еден куп секојдневни проблеми. Испитувањата се обединуваат: учесниците на првиот Слурм, како Дружината на прстенот, сè уште комуницираат едни со други.

Slurm: гасеница претворена во пеперутка
Вака изгледаше Slurm-1

На првиот Slurm се роди идејата за одржување на MegaSlurm. Ги прашавме луѓето кои теми ги интересираат, а во октомври одржавме напреден курс „По барање на учесниците“. Се покажа како интересен, но еднократен настан. До мај '19 подготвивме вистински напреден курс, со своја логика и внатрешна историја.

Во текот на годината, Slurm се промени организациски:
— Докер и Анисбл беа отстранети од главната програма и направија посебни онлајн курсеви.
— Организирана техничка поддршка која им помага на учениците да ги решат проблемите со кластерите за учење.
- Говорниците сега имаат методолошка поддршка.

Slurm: гасеница претворена во пеперутка
Тимот кој го направи Слурм 4

Повратни информации од учесниците

Поставен е уште еден рекорд: 170 учесници во основниот Слурм, 75 во МегаСлурм.

Slurm: гасеница претворена во пеперутка

Случај-4
101 од 170 луѓе го пополниле формуларот за повратни информации.

Дали Кубернетес стана јасен?
41 — Сè уште не ги разбирам k8s, но гледам каде да копам.
36 - Не ги знаев k8s порано, но сега го сфатив.
23 — Ги знаев k8s порано, но сега знам подобро.
1 - Не научив ништо ново.
0 - Не разбрав ништо за k8s.

Како ви се допаѓа интензитетот на Slurm?

16 луѓе мислат дека Slurm е премногу лесен и бавен, а 14 луѓе мислат дека е премногу тежок и брз. Точно за останатото.

Дали го решивте проблемот со кој одевте на Слурм?

90 - Да.
11 - бр.

МегаСлурм

40 луѓе го пополнија формуларот за повратни информации. 2 луѓе рекоа дека е премногу лесно и бавно. 1 лице не го реши проблемот со кој одеше во Мега. Останатите се во ред.

Преглед на Slurm на https://serveradmin.ru

Осврти на звучници

Slurm: гасеница претворена во пеперутка

Ако на Санкт Петербург Слурм во февруари имаше претежно почетници, тогаш на Московскиот Слурм луѓето во голем број веќе го испробаа Кубернет. Имаше многу напредни прашања што ве натераа да размислите.

Ако во Санкт Петербург прашаа кога ќе ја објавиме нашата вилушка за кубеспреј, тогаш во Москва веќе прашаа зошто предлагаме да ја користиме нашата вилушка и да не го земаме оригиналниот кубеспреј. Ова е веќе критичко размислување на средните постари.

Практиката беше тешка, луѓето правеа многу грешки, и тоа е одлично: треба да правите грешки додека студирате, а не во битка.

Редовно наидувавме на ограничувања за добивање сертификати, ограничувања за преземање од Github итн. Ова е животот - истовремено распоредивме околу 200 кластери во облакот Selectel. Никој не ги подготвува своите ресурси и граници за ова.

Објава на Слурм во Селектел

Регистрација за Slurm-5
Цена: 25 ₽

Програма:

Тема бр. 1: Вовед во Кубернет, главни компоненти
— Вовед во технологијата k8s. Опис, апликација, концепти
— Pod, ReplicaSet, Deployment, Service, Ingress, PV, PVC, ConfigMap, Secret

Тема бр. 2: Дизајн на кластери, главни компоненти, толеранција на грешки, мрежа k8s
— Дизајн на кластер, главни компоненти, толеранција на грешки
— k8s мрежа

Тема бр. 3: Kubespray, подесување и поставување кластер Kubernetes
— Kubespray, конфигурација и подесување на кластерот Kubernetes

Тема бр. 4: Напредни кубернетес апстракции
- DaemonSet, StatefulSet, RBAC, Job, CronJob, Pod Scheduling, InitContainer

Тема #5: Издавачки услуги и апликации
— Преглед на методите за објавување услуги: NodePort vs LoadBalancer vs Ingress
— Контролор за влез (Nginx): балансирање на дојдовниот сообраќај
— Сert-менаџер: автоматски добивајте SSL/TLS сертификати

Тема бр. 6: Вовед во Хелм

Тема бр. 7: Инсталирање на серт-менаџер

Тема бр. 8: Цеф: инсталација „направи како јас“.

Тема бр. 9: Евиденција и следење
— Кластерски мониторинг, Прометеј
— Вклучување на кластери, Fluentd/Elastic/Kibana

Тема #10: Ажурирање на кластерот

Тема бр. 11: Практична работа, докеризација на апликации и лансирање во кластер

Курсевите за Docker и Ansible на stepik.org се вклучени во цената.

Регистрација за Slurm DevOps
Цена: 45 ₽

Програма:

Тема бр. 1: Вовед во Git
— Основни команди git init, commit, add, diff, log, status, pull, push
— Поставување на локалната средина: практични препораки
— Git flow, гранки и ознаки, стратегии за спојување
— Работа со повеќе далечински репо

Тема бр. 2: Тимска работа со Git
— Тек на GitHub
— Вилушка, извадете, повлечете барање
— Конфликти, изданија, уште еднаш за Gitflow и други текови во однос на тимовите

Тема бр. 3: CI/CD вовед во автоматизација
— Автоматизација во git (ботови, вовед во CI, куки)
- Алатки (баши, направи, граѓа)
— Фабрички монтажни линии и нивна примена во ИТ

Тема #4: CI/CD: Работа со Gitlab
- Изградете, тестирајте, распоредете
— Фази, променливи, контрола на извршување (само, кога, вклучи)

Тема бр. 5: Работа со апликацијата од развојна гледна точка
— Ние пишуваме микросервис во Python (вклучувајќи тестови)
— Користење docker-compose во развојот

Тема #6: Инфраструктурата како код
— IaC: пристап кон инфраструктурата како код
— IaC користејќи Terraform како пример
— IaC користејќи Ansible како пример
— Идемпотенција, декларативност
— Вежбајте да креирате книги за игри Ansible
— Складирање на конфигурации, соработка, автоматизација на апликации

Тема #7: Инфраструктурно тестирање
— Тестирање и континуирана интеграција со Molecule и Gitlab CI

Тема бр. 8: Автоматизација на подигање на сервери
— Собирање слики
- PXE и ​​DHCP

Тема #9: Автоматизација на инфраструктурата
— Пример за инфраструктурна услуга за авторизација на сервери
— ChatOps (интеграција на инстант-месинџери со цевководи)

Тема #10: Безбедносна автоматизација
— Потпишување артефакти CI/CD
— Скенирање на ранливост

Тема #11: Мониторинг
— Дефиниција на SLA, SLO, Error Budget и други застрашувачки термини од светот на SRE
— SRE: Пракса за следење на SLI и SLO
— SRE: Пракса за користење на Буџетот за грешки
- SRE: Управување со прекини и оперативно оптоварување (апигатвеј, сервисна мрежа, прекинувачи)
— Следење на цевководи и развојни метрика

Извор: www.habr.com

Додадете коментар